NVIDIA Terraform Kubernetes Modules

Objective

NVIDIA Terraform Modules provide a reference architecture for deploying CSP managed Kubernetes clusters equipped with NVIDIA softwares:

  • NVIDIA GPU Operator.
  • NVIDIA NIM Operator.

All the components listed below have been tested successfully together.

Life Cycle

When NVIDIA Terraform Modules is released, the previous release enters maintenance support and only receives patch release updates. All prior batches enter end-of-life (EOL) and are no longer supported and do not receive patch updates.

Release Status
25.4.0 Generally Available
24.11.0 Maintenance

Support Matrix

The Kubernetes clusters provisioned by the modules in this repository provide tested and certified versions of Kubernetes, the NVIDIA GPU operator, and NVIDIA NIM Operator.

If your application does not require a specific version of Kubernetes, we recommend using the latest available version. We also recommend you plan to upgrade your version of Kubernetes at least every 6 months.

Infrastructure as code for GPU accelerated managed Kubernetes clusters. These scripts automate the deployment of GPU-Enabled Kubernetes clusters on various cloud service platforms.

Terraform is an open-source infrastructure as code software tool that we will use to automate the deployment of Kubernetes clusters with the required add-ons to enable NVIDIA GPUs. This repository contains Terraform modules, which are sets of Terraform configuration files ready for deployment. The modules in this repository can be incorporated into existing Terraform-managed infrastructure, or used to set up new infrastructure from scratch. You can learn more about Terraform here.

State Management

These modules do not set up state management for the generated Terraform state file, deleting the statefile (terraform.tfstate) generated by Terraform could result in cloud resources needing to be manually deleted. We strongly encourage you configure remote state.
